Burglar Who Tried to Force His Way Into Anya Taylor-Joy’s Bedroom Gets Three Years

Prosecutors kept the case to reflect an escalating pattern despite his existing life term.

Overview

  • Masked intruders broke into a London mansion on February 12, 2023, and Malcolm McRae barricaded himself and Anya Taylor-Joy in their bedroom, scaring the raiders off by claiming he had a gun.
  • Forensic evidence linked Kirk Holdrick to the scene, including DNA on a door and shoe prints outside the bedroom.
  • Holdrick was arrested on April 18, 2023 after stepping off a Belfast–Liverpool ferry, initially denied involvement, and pleaded guilty in mid-December.
  • The Crown Prosecution Service pursued the London burglary charge and Holdrick was sentenced on December 12 at Woolwich Crown Court to three years.
  • Nine days after the London break-in, Holdrick joined a violent Sandbanks home invasion disguised as police, earning a 12-year term, and Taylor-Joy and McRae told police they were traumatized and feared being targeted again.
